Pros

Career Growth: Starting as an IA and moving into roles like lead teacher, substitute teacher, and now admin shows significant career development and learning opportunities. Impact on Students: You have the privilege of seeing students grow, learn, and become more independent over time, which is incredibly rewarding. Variety and Challenge: Every day presents new challenges, keeping the job dynamic and engaging. Team Support: You work with a dedicated team of colleagues who all share the same goal of helping students succeed, offering a collaborative and supportive environment. Professional Fulfillment: Witnessing students' progress and being part of their journey provides a deep sense of accomplishment and pride.

Cons

Emotional Demands: Working closely with students and their challenges can be emotionally taxing, especially when trying to help them overcome personal or academic hurdles. Constant Change: Challenges can sometimes make it difficult to maintain a consistent routine. High Responsibility: .
